"Kim Thailand" arrested and escorted off the Hanoi premises during Trump/Kim summit

Vietnamese police arrested a Thai man who was posing as Kim Jong Un in Hanoi as the North Korean leader was meeting US president Donald Trump. 

 

Uthen Leuangsaengthong, 41, is known as "Kim Thailand". He is a marketing executive who made 100 million baht by the age of 40.

 

He had planned a three day trip to Vietnam from 25th to 27th February to coincide with the summit. 

 

Sanook reported that after he visited a famous Hanoi lake he went to the area of the summit where a large number of Vietnamese residents and tourists wanted selfies. 

 

This attracted the attention of the Vietnamese police who took him into custody as he tried to get back to his hotel in a taxi. 

 

5a.jpg

 

He was interrogated for two hours in which it was discovered that he posed no security threat.

 

However, he was still kept in the custody of the authorities (along with an Egyptian man) and escorted to the airport before being put on his scheduled flight back to Bangkok yesterday afternoon. 

 

"Kim Thailand" was in a news a couple of weeks ago after complaining that his newly purchased 2.8 million baht Harley Davidson motorcycle was constantly breaking down.
